摘要:针对传统数据采集系统的不足,文中介绍了一种基于ARM9的数据采集系统的设计原理和实现方法;以微处理器S3C2440A为核心,外扩高精度A/D芯片AD7606,设计了数据采集硬件电路,分析了AD7606和PWM定时器的基本工作原理,借助于移植的嵌入式Linux操作系统,实现了基于PWM和GPIO口的ADC驱动及相应的数据缓冲与软件抗干扰;测试结果表明,由ARM和Linux组成的数据采集系统具有操作方便、采集精度高和测量结果准确等优点.
注:因版权方要求,不能公开全文,如需全文,请咨询杂志社